South Korea Ham and Bacon Market Overview

The South Korea ham and bacon market has experienced steady growth over recent years, driven by evolving consumer preferences and increasing demand for processed meat products. As of 2023, the market size is estimated at approximately USD 1.2 billion, with projections indicating a compound annual growth rate (CAGR) of around 4.5% over the next five years. By 2028, the market is forecasted to reach nearly USD 1.6 billion, reflecting ongoing consumer interest and expanding product portfolios. The rising popularity of Western-style breakfast foods, coupled with the influence of global culinary trends, continues to bolster demand for ham and bacon products across retail and foodservice channels. Additionally, the increasing penetration of modern retail formats and e-commerce platforms has facilitated wider access to these products, further fueling market expansion.

South Korea Ham and Bacon Market Restraints

Despite positive growth prospects, the South Korea ham and bacon market faces several challenges that could temper expansion. These restraints include health concerns, regulatory pressures, and fluctuating raw material costs.

  • Growing consumer awareness of health issues related to processed meats, such as high sodium and preservative content, limits consumption growth.
  • Stringent food safety regulations and labeling requirements increase compliance costs for manufacturers.
  • Volatility in raw material prices, especially pork, impacts profit margins and pricing strategies.
  • Environmental concerns related to meat production and sustainability practices may restrict market development.

These challenges influence market dynamics by prompting manufacturers to innovate in healthier product formulations and adopt more sustainable practices. Regulatory compliance necessitates investments in quality control and transparency, which can increase operational costs. Fluctuating raw material prices require strategic sourcing and inventory management to maintain profitability. Additionally, health-conscious consumers are shifting preferences toward plant-based alternatives, posing a long-term threat to traditional ham and bacon products. Addressing these restraints will require industry players to balance innovation with regulatory adherence and sustainability commitments to sustain growth in South Korea’s competitive market environment.
